0

我正在尝试使用 xlutils 包来处理带有 python 的 excel 文件,但是当我导入这个包并点击 TAB (IPython) 来查看属性时,它是空的!

import xlutils
xlutils.  #hit tab here. Nothing appears.

我安装了最新版本的 xlrd、xlwt 和 xlutils。有人对这个问题有任何想法吗?

提前致谢, Rhenan

4

2 回答 2

0

这很奇怪,我导入xlutilsdir(xlutils)给了我:

['__builtins__', '__doc__', '__file__', '__name__', '__package', '__path__']

然后我用 阅读了帮助字符串help(xlutils),它说:

PACKAGE CONTENTS
    copy
    display
    filter
    margins
    save
    styles
    tests (package)

我尝试运行它import xlutils.copydir(xlutils)更改了结果,所以我相信您可以在导入xlutils.copy或其他您想要的内容后自动完成它。

于 2013-10-15T07:05:04.343 回答
0

在我看来,他们打算让您使用包中的模块,而不是直接使用包根目录。

help(xlutils)给出你可以使用的模块列表。

from xlutils import copy使您可以访问该功能。

帮助字符串似乎指向网络,因此这可能是您寻求帮助的最佳选择。

于 2013-10-15T05:04:15.907 回答